SB64 UBE is a 2014 Abarth 500 in Grey with a 1,368c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 69.2%.
Across all 2014 Abarth 500 models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.0% with a typical mileage of 41,032 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Abarth 500 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,205 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SB64 UBE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Abarth 500 typically stays on UK roads for around 17 years. At 12 years old, this Abarth 500 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
